Michele Chiarlo Barbaresco Asili 2000

Montforte d'Alba, Cuneo, Piedmont, ItalyPeppery, tar, black cherry, truffle, barnyard, tea and coffee nose, very aromatic. Dry, round, elegant style with light tannins, nearly ready. Smoky, resin, leather, dried cherry, mineral flavours with a tobacco, sour cherry finish. Very good finesse but young should improve over the next 2-5 years. A bit Burgundian like in style.Tasted: 13 March 2007Tasted by: Anthony Gismondi and Stuart TobePrices:
